Ernest "Ernie" Elmer Fleming, age 78 of Rossford, Ohio passed away on March 26, 2015 at Hospice of Northwest Ohio surrounded by his family. He was born on February 28, 1937 in Vermillion, OH to Elmer C. and Alice (Howell) Fleming. Ernie was a graduate of Vermillion High School and proudly served his country in the United States Army during the Vietnam War. After being honorably discharged Ernie went to work in his hometown of Vermillion at Kyle Motors and then Fulper Autoparts. Later he moved to Rossford and worked as a grounds keeper for various commercial properties in the area. Ernie was a 32nd Degree Mason and was quite the collector. He enjoyed ice cream and especially enjoyed his time with family and his many friends in Rossford.
